VALENTINE on the CW!

I'm excited to announce that I've just been cast in a brand new show for the CW called "Valentine".  It's an hour-long, romantic comedy from creator Kevin Murphy (Desperate Housewives, Reaper) that focuses on mythological gods and goddesses of love and war. I play Kate Providence, a (human) romance novelist who stumbles upon a mysterious woman (Jaime Murray) and ends up being enlisted to help her and her mythological brood put soul mates together.  We will start airing mid-September so keep an eye out for it!  

The cast is a lot of fun- Jaime (Dexter), Kris Polaha (Miss Guided), Robert Baker (Leatherheads), Greg Ellis (Pirates of the Caribbean, 24) and Autum Reeser (The O.C.).  Since I don't have any pictures from set yet (we just started this week) here's a dorky one of my in my trailer playing around with photo booth
